A much-loved teacher who inspired many has been remembered as “loving, warm, caring” over her 39 years of teaching.

Former Woree State School teacher from 1987 to 2014, Shauna Roche died on Sunday September 11 at Townsville Hospital.

Mrs Roche started with Education Queensland in 1977 at Healy State School for two years, worked at Townsview State School in 1979 and at Yorkeys Knob State School from 1980 to 1986.

Tributes have been pouring by friends, family, past students and colleagues over the last few days.

Shelly Stitt, 29, said Mrs Roche was not only her Year 1 teacher but she also taught three of her siblings.

“She was honestly, she had the personality of your mum. She was loving, warm, caring, she took the scare out of going to school,” she said.

“She created a warm and safe environment that made you want to go to school.”

Ms Stitt said she was a very special teacher to her and influenced her life even from an early age.

“There’s always one teacher that you remember so many fond memories of and the one that impacted your life,” she said.

“She inspired me to become a teacher. She was the kind of person I looked at and I said I want to be you when you’re older.”

Memories from that first year at school are usually difficult but there’s one moment Ms Stitt remembers so clearly.

“On our very first day of school. I was so upset and Mrs Roche had her big well welcoming arms, she sat you on her lap and she pretty much mothered you,” she said.

Over her time as a teacher she influenced many. Woree State School principal Terry Davidson said she had a positive spirit, a huge smile and was an amazing teacher.

“Shauna was a dedicated and much loved early year’s educator who made a difference and created life long memories for the many children she taught as a teacher of Woree State School,” she said.

“She is remembered clearly by many as their favourite teacher in their childhood who will be sadly missed.

“Teachers talk of the privilege of working alongside Shauna.”

Ms Davidson said she was a generous soul who left a huge impression on everyone she met.

“Shauna was an amazing colleague and friend to so many staff, sharing her knowledge and thoughts, always a pleasure to be around,” she said.
